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
66055788114 7222996870 642 416507947
51342870 4311 041228
51342870 4311 041228
32209828 249 65998882 330258292
All about undefined
Interested in learning more?
51342870 4311 041228
32209828 249 65998882 330258292
See more
5843464 831948739 535824049
386 0195954407 91
See more
22839 148711 682
248634013 83725776228 9823275
See more